<p><em>Three days ago we introduced the <a href="http://beijingcream.com/2012/05/1st-annual-beijing-cream-bar-and-club-awards/">1st annual Beijing Cream Bar and Club Awards</a> (image credit Katie), with 22 questions divided into five categories. We&#8217;ve had contributions from <a href="http://beijingcream.com/2012/05/bjc-bar-and-club-awards-a-closer-look-at-the-dross-category/">Piper Fisco</a>, <a href="http://beijingcream.com/2012/05/bjc-bar-and-club-awards-a-closer-look-at-the-repugnance-category/">E</a>, <a href="http://beijingcream.com/2012/05/bjc-bar-and-club-awards-a-closer-look-at-the-alcoholism-category-part-1/">Kevin Reitz</a> and <a href="http://beijingcream.com/2012/05/bjc-bar-and-club-awards-an-alcoholic-takes-a-closer-look-at-the-alcoholism-category/">Scott Grow</a>. To examine the fourth of our five categories, Meta, we&#8217;ve invited somewhat of a bar expert. It&#8217;s all too fitting.</em></p>
<p><strong><em>By Loretta Fu</em></strong></p>
<p><em>Why Even Call it Happy Hour if You&#8217;re Only Going to Lower Prices on Tsingtaos by 5 Kuai (i.e. The Tim&#8217;s Texas BBQ Award)</em></p>
<ul>
<li>Fubar</li>
<li>Great Leap Brewing</li>
<li>Paddy O&#8217;Shea&#8217;s</li>
<li>Tim&#8217;s Texas BBQ</li>
<li>Union</li>
</ul>
<p>Seeing as Great Leap does not have a happy hour to be spoken of, they are automatically out of the running. I think <strong>Tim’s Texas BBQ</strong> takes the cake on this one.</p>
<p><em>Way Too Far For You to Care<span id="more-2580"></span></em></p>
<ul>
<li>Frank&#8217;s Place</li>
<li>The Green Cap</li>
<li>The Irish Volunteer</li>
<li>The Pomegranate</li>
<li>Swan Lake</li>
</ul>
<p>I really don’t care about any of them. But if I had to choose the one I cared LEAST about, I suppose <strong>Swan Lake</strong>. I don’t even care enough to know what that bar is. And I bet it’s really far away. <em>[Editor's note: I can't remember where I saw mention of this bar called "Swan Lake," but now that I try to find it online, I can't. Did I just make the bar up? Would appreciate hearing from someone who's actually been to Swan Lake, which may or may not exist in Beijing.]</em></p>
<p><em>Absolutely, Positively Worst Music</em></p>
<ul>
<li>Haze</li>
<li>Kokomo</li>
<li>Lantern</li>
<li>Red Club</li>
<li>White Rabbit</li>
</ul>
<p>I hate electronic music, so this one is really like shooting fish in a barrel. I&#8230; hate… Lantern. If the music was actually at a volume that you could bear, then maybe it would be excused. But my eardrums bleed every time I walk in there. <strong>Lantern</strong> gets my vote for worst music.</p>
<p><em>Least Likely to be Featured in Any Kind of Bar/Club Award</em></p>
<ul>
<li>9.9</li>
<li>The Awesomeness Bar</li>
<li>Cheers</li>
<li>Pure Girl</li>
<li>Souk Lounge</li>
</ul>
<p>Only in China would there be bars that have these names. Awesomeness Bar is clearly screaming for attention, but I won’t give it the satisfaction of winning ANYTHING. Cocky bitch. Also won’t dignify Pure Girl with anything. Perhaps <strong>9.9</strong> is the least offensive to me, enough that it’ll get my vote.</p>
<p><em>Bar You Have Not Been to But is Actually Not Bad</em></p>
<ul>
<li>Ball House</li>
<li>Contempio Temple Bar</li>
<li>Doron</li>
<li>Jiggly Wiggly</li>
<li>Revolution</li>
<li>What Bar</li>
</ul>
<p>I’ve heard good things about all of these places. I’ve heard that Temple Bar is big. I’ve heard that Ball House has foosball. Big ups for <strong>Ball House</strong> having foosball. I vote for them.</p>
